A Registered DIMM is a memory module designed for network servers and high end workstations. A SODIMM (Small Outline Dual In-line Memory Module) is a memory module with a smaller outline and thickness than standard DIMM modules and designed primarily for notebook computers. WebDIMM (dual in-line memory module): A DIMM (dual in-line memory module) is a double SIMM (single in-line memory module). Like a SIMM, a DIMM is a module that contains one or several random access memory ( RAM ) chips on a small circuit board with pins that connect it to the computer motherboard . rue rothier troyes
